How do I get a data center job in Herndon?
Focus your search on the Dulles Technology Corridor and the clusters of cloud, colocation, and federal IT contractors concentrated around Route 28 and the Herndon-Monroe area. Employers here consistently look for hands-on experience with server hardware, networking equipment, or facilities systems. Certifications such as CompTIA Server+, DCCA, or Cisco CCNA give candidates a clear edge in this market, where competition from neighboring Ashburn candidates is real.

Are there remote data center jobs in Herndon?
Yes, but only for certain roles. Hands-on positions such as data center technician, facilities engineer, and cabling specialist require on-site presence and are almost never remote. About 10% of data center openings tied to Herndon are remote or hybrid as of August 2026, and those openings tend to be in NOC monitoring, capacity planning, and sales engineering rather than physical infrastructure work.
How can I get a data center job in Herndon with little or no experience?
The most realistic entry path in Herndon is through a data center technician or facilities operations associate role with one of the colocation or managed services providers along the Route 28 corridor. These employers regularly hire candidates who hold an associate degree in IT or a CompTIA A+ certification even without prior data center time. Volunteering for overnight or weekend shifts, which see the most turnover locally, can also move an application to the top of the review queue.
